The sample of 15 galaxy clusters published by Dressler and Shectman (1988) has been analyzed to search for a tendency for spiral and irregular galaxies to have greater velocity dispersion than the ellipticals and lenticulars. It is shown that this trend is highly significant, with a probability of less than 0.05 percent that it may result from statistical fluctuations in the sample of clusters. An analogous but much less significant effect appears also to be present between lenticular and elliptical galaxies. These results are interpreted as evidence that late-type galaxies are still in the process of infalling toward the virialized cluster cores. 34 refs.
